The Office of Mental Retardation and Developmental Disabilities (OMRDD) provides person-centered services, supports and advocacy to individuals with developmental disabilities and their families. The goal of OMRDD is to help people with developmental disabilities achieve their personal best and attain the highest level of independence through individualized service programs. This course identifies some of the most commonly requested supports available throught the OMRDD system. (3 hours)
